Understanding the Click Connect System

The Graco Click Connect System is a core feature, enabling a secure and effortless attachment of compatible Graco infant car seats directly to the stroller frame. This eliminates the need to wake the baby during transfers, a significant benefit for parents. The system utilizes a simple, one-hand click-in mechanism, providing both convenience and peace of mind.

Before use, it’s vital to confirm compatibility between the car seat and stroller model, as detailed in the respective user manuals. Attaching the Wheels

Begin by inverting the stroller frame to access the wheel attachment points. Typically, Graco Click Connect strollers utilize a simple push-button mechanism. Align each wheel with its corresponding socket and firmly push until you hear a distinct click, confirming secure attachment.

Ensure all wheels are properly locked into place before proceeding. Gently attempt to wiggle each wheel to verify stability. If a wheel doesn’t click securely, re-align and try again. Refer to your model’s specific manual for detailed diagrams and instructions, as attachment methods can vary slightly. Correct wheel installation is crucial for smooth maneuverability and safe operation of your stroller.

Clicking in Infant Car Seats

The Graco Click Connect system simplifies attaching your infant car seat to the stroller. Ensure the car seat is properly aligned with the stroller’s receiving brackets. You’ll hear a distinct “click” sound when the car seat is securely locked into place.

Before each use, always verify the secure attachment by firmly pulling up on the car seat handle. It should not detach from the stroller. When using a rain cover, ensure the harness anchor is turned towards the infant car seat before folding the stroller to prevent damage.

Refer to both the stroller and car seat manuals for specific compatibility information and detailed instructions. Incorrect installation can compromise safety, so double-check everything!

Adjusting the Harness System

Properly adjusting the harness is crucial for your child’s safety and comfort. Locate the harness straps and the height adjustment slots on the stroller seat. Ensure the straps are not twisted. Adjust the shoulder straps to the appropriate height, corresponding with your child’s size – typically at or just below their shoulders for rear-facing, and at or above for forward-facing.

Tighten the harness straps until they are snug, but not overly tight, allowing a finger’s width between the strap and your child’s collarbone. Always use both the shoulder and waist straps together. Regularly check the harness for wear and tear, and ensure all buckles are functioning correctly.

Cleaning the Stroller

Maintaining a clean stroller is crucial for hygiene and longevity. Regularly wipe down the frame and fabrics with a damp cloth and mild soap. For tougher stains, a diluted solution of gentle detergent can be used, but always test in an inconspicuous area first.

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ners as they can damage the materials. Removable fabric covers can often be machine washed on a delicate cycle with cold water; always check the care label. Ensure all parts are completely dry before reassembling. Pay attention to the harness straps and buckle, cleaning them thoroughly to remove any dirt or debris. Regularly inspect and clean the wheels to remove any buildup that could affect maneuverability.

Checking for Wear and Tear

Regularly inspect your Graco Click Connect stroller for signs of wear and tear to ensure continued safety and functionality. Examine the frame for any cracks, bends, or corrosion. Check the wheels for smooth rotation and secure attachment, looking for any loose spokes or damaged tires.

Pay close attention to the harness system, verifying that the straps are intact, buckles function correctly, and adjustment mechanisms operate smoothly. Inspect the fabric for rips, tears, or fading. Ensure all locking mechanisms, including the brake and Click Connect attachments, engage and disengage properly; Replace any worn or damaged parts immediately to maintain the stroller’s safety standards.

Lubrication of Moving Parts

To maintain smooth operation, periodically lubricate the moving parts of your Graco Click Connect stroller. Focus on the wheel axles, swivel mechanisms, and folding hinges. Use a silicone-based lubricant specifically designed for baby gear; avoid oil-based products as they can attract dirt and grime.

Apply a small amount of lubricant to each moving part, ensuring it penetrates into the mechanism. Wipe away any excess lubricant to prevent staining or attracting debris. Regularly lubricating these areas will reduce friction, prevent corrosion, and extend the lifespan of your stroller. Avoid over-lubrication, as this can also attract dirt. Check the stroller’s manual for specific lubrication recommendations.

Stroller Not Folding Properly

If your Graco Click Connect stroller resists folding, first ensure the seat is facing forward. Confirm the stroller is on a level surface, free from obstructions. Double-check that all locking mechanisms are disengaged – often a secondary lock needs releasing alongside the primary folding trigger.

Inspect the area around the folding hinges for any trapped fabric or debris. A slight rocking motion while activating the folding mechanism can sometimes help. If the issue persists, verify the handlebar is fully extended or retracted, as some models require a specific handlebar position for proper folding.

Avoid forcing the fold, as this could damage the frame. Refer to your specific model’s manual for diagrams illustrating the correct folding sequence.

Difficulty Clicking in Car Seat

Encountering trouble securing your infant car seat to the Graco Click Connect stroller? Ensure the car seat’s base is correctly aligned with the stroller’s receiving brackets. Listen for a distinct “click” sound – this confirms a secure attachment. Avoid forcing the car seat; misalignment is the most common cause.

Verify the Click Connect adapter (if applicable to your model) is properly installed and functioning. Sometimes, a slight rotation or jiggle of the car seat while applying gentle pressure can facilitate connection. Check for any obstructions within the receiving brackets, like debris or fabric.

Always harness the infant before attempting to click the car seat into the stroller. Refer to your stroller and car seat manuals for specific instructions and diagrams.

Wheel Issues

Experiencing problems with your Graco Click Connect stroller’s wheels? First, confirm they are securely attached – a clicking sound indicates proper installation. If a wheel feels loose, re-insert it, ensuring it locks into place. Check for any debris, like hair or fabric, obstructing the wheel axles.

For wheels that aren’t rotating smoothly, a simple lubrication of the axle with a silicone-based lubricant can often resolve the issue. Avoid using oil-based lubricants, as they can attract dirt. Inspect the wheels for any visible damage, such as cracks or flat spots.

If a wheel is completely stuck, gently try to wiggle it free while applying slight pressure. Consult the manual for specific wheel removal instructions for your model.

Rain Cover Usage and Ventilation

Utilizing the rain cover effectively requires attention to ventilation. When deployed, always double-check for sufficient airflow to prevent overheating and ensure your child’s comfort. The rain cover creates a sealed environment, potentially trapping moisture and increasing temperature. Regularly inspect the cover for any damage that might restrict airflow.

Ensure the cover’s vents are unobstructed and consider pausing use if condensation builds up inside. Remember to harness anchor and turn the anchor to the infant car seat before folding with the rain cover attached. Proper ventilation is crucial, especially during warmer weather, to maintain a safe and comfortable environment for your little one during inclement conditions.
